Very poor performance on modern systems
- Due to poor OpenGL support with Nvidia and AMD GPU drivers under Windows 8.1 and later systems, the game is unable to use the hardware properly.[citation needed]
- This may greatly improve the frame rate but not entirely fix it. With V-Sync turned off through the GPU control panel, the game may still not go beyond a certain frame rate depending on the system. Setting "Max Frame Rate" (on Nvidia GPUs) to a value like 240 FPS can increase performance by a small amount in-game and also fully unlock performance in menus (if V-Sync is off).
Enable Sleepless Window Thread in Special K
|
- Download Special K.
- Copy
SpecialK32.dll to the game folder (where WormsMayhem.exe is located).
- Rename
SpecialK32.dll to OPENGL32.dll .
- Start the game and exit.
- Open
OpenGL32.ini in the game folder.
- Change
SleeplessWindowThread=false to SleeplessWindowThread=true under [Render.FrameRate] .

Sepia filter in the Worms 3D campaign
Remove color filter by editing configuration files.[2]
|
- Go to
<path-to-game>\CG .
- Open
PostProcess.cg .
- Find the line
c = float4(lerp(col, brightness * sepiaColour.rgb, sepiaColour.a), 1.0); .
- Replace with
c = float4(col, 1.0); .

Improper scaling when system-wide scaling is set
Disable system DPI scaling[citation needed]
|
- Find
WormsMayhem.exe .
- Right click and open properties.
- Under compatibility, open high DPI settings and disable display scaling.
